The Microscopic Reality of Glass Surfaces

In my 25 years as a master glazier, I have seen every imaginable mistake a homeowner or a ‘caulk-and-walk’ installer can make. People think glass is a flat, solid object. It is not. At a microscopic level, glass is a landscape of peaks and valleys. When you use a standard paper towel or a rag to clean your windows, you are essentially dragging lint and binders across a jagged terrain. This is where the streak begins. The ‘Coffee Filter Secret’ is not just a grandmother’s tale; it is rooted in the physical properties of the paper. Coffee filters are designed for high-heat, high-pressure environments where they cannot disintegrate or leave behind particulate matter. Unlike paper towels, which are held together by adhesives and binders that dissolve when they hit an ammonia-based cleaner, coffee filters are pure, lint-free cellulose. When you apply this to a window repair or a standard window cleaner routine, you are engaging in a mechanical cleaning process that leaves zero residue behind.

If your goal is a streak-free finish, you are likely someone who cares about the clarity of your view. But that clarity is often obscured by seal failure, not just dirt. If you see a haze that won’t go away no matter how many coffee filters you use, you are looking at desiccant saturation. Inside your insulated glass unit (IGU), there is a spacer bar filled with desiccant. Once that desiccant is full of moisture, it starts to off-gas, creating a permanent fog on surface #2 or #3 of the glass. No window cleaner in the world can fix that; you are looking at a glass replacement or a full sash swap.

The Physics of the Streak and the North/Cold Climate Logic

In our northern climate, where the enemy is heat loss and the constant battle against the dew point, the way we clean and maintain windows changes. We prioritize the U-Factor, which measures the rate of heat transfer. A lower U-Factor means better insulation. When you have high-performance glass with a Low-E coating on surface #3, you are reflecting long-wave infrared radiation back into the room. However, this coating is sensitive. If you are cleaning a window and you use an abrasive cloth, you risk micro-scratching. This is why the coffee filter is the superior tool. It provides just enough mechanical friction to lift mineral deposits without compromising the integrity of the glazing bead or the glass surface itself.

When we talk about window repair, we often focus on the hardware or the wood rot in the sill pan, but the cleanliness of the glass is what dictates the solar heat gain performance to a degree. Dirt buildup can actually increase the absorption of heat on the glass, raising the temperature of the pane and potentially stressing the seals. By using a coffee filter and a solution of distilled water and a drop of dish soap, you ensure that the meniscus of the water breaks evenly across the glass. Tap water contains calcium and magnesium. As the water evaporates, these minerals stay behind, trapped in the microscopic valleys I mentioned earlier. Distilled water lacks these minerals, and the coffee filter absorbs the liquid so rapidly through capillary action that the minerals never have a chance to settle.

The Anatomy of a Proper Clean: Beyond the Glass

A true professional knows that you don’t just clean the glass; you inspect the system. While you are using your coffee filter, you should be looking at your weep holes. These are the small outlets at the bottom of the frame designed to allow water to exit the assembly. If these are clogged with debris or ‘caulk-and-walk’ residue, water will back up into the rough opening, causing rot in the header and the jack studs. I have pulled out windows where the entire framing was black with mold because the homeowner spent all their time cleaning the glass but never checked the weep holes or the integrity of the flashing tape.

If you are considering a move to replace windows, don’t just look at the price tag. Look at the spacer system. Avoid traditional aluminum spacers. They are thermal bridges that conduct cold from the outside directly to the inner pane, causing condensation. Look for warm-edge spacers made of structural foam or thermoplastic. These move with the glass as it expands and contracts, which is vital in regions where the temperature can swing fifty degrees in a single day. When the glass moves, the glazing bead must remain flexible. If the bead is brittle and cracked, air and water will bypass the glass and enter the sash, leading to the eventual failure of the IGU.

The Coffee Filter Technique: A Step-by-Step Glazier’s Method

First, ignore the blue sprays found in grocery stores. They are often loaded with waxes that create a temporary shine but attract dust within hours. Mix a solution of 50% distilled water and 50% isopropyl alcohol. The alcohol lowers the freezing point and speeds up evaporation, which is critical when cleaning in colder months. Spray the solution sparingly on the glass. Take your first coffee filter and fold it into a square. This provides a flat, firm surface. Wipe in a vertical motion on the interior and a horizontal motion on the exterior. This way, if a streak does appear, you know exactly which side it is on. Once the bulk of the moisture is removed, take a fresh, dry coffee filter and buff the glass in a circular motion. This generates a slight static charge that actually helps repel dust for several weeks. This isn’t magic; it is the science of surface tension and lint-free application.

As you work, pay attention to the muntins and the sash. If you have removable grilles, take them off. Cleaning around them is where most people fail, leaving a ring of residue that eventually eats away at the finish of the wood or the vinyl. If you find that the sash is sticking, do not force it. This is often a sign that the window was not shimmed correctly during installation. A window that is out of plumb or square will bind, and no amount of cleaning will make it operate smoothly. In these cases, window repair becomes a structural issue rather than a maintenance one.
